Yukon Posted March 27, 2006 #3 Share Posted March 27, 2006 Denali to Talkeetna is 153 miles - figure 3 hours to be safe, but it will actually be a bit less, as traffic for most of that route (the Parks Highway part) moves along at 60-65 mph usually. Budget Queen Posted March 27, 2006 #5 Share Posted March 27, 2006 I say allow 3 1/2 hours, the Spur Road can be slow, and you never know what you are going to get behind on the Parks. I would book a later flight anyway. This highway can offer some ad lib stops, that may be of interest.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Budget Queen Posted March 28, 2006 #7 Share Posted March 28, 2006 I would still suggest you may want to consider scheduling this for your trip to Denali Park- if a priority. These flights are sometimes canceled. My last trip had 4 reschedules and never did make it. :( As another suggestion- I would leave Denali Park late afternoon/evening and do the drive then to Talkeetna. You will need to be at Talkeetna Aero by 10:30am, you may want to call them and make sure the flight is going if iffy weather, then reschedule over the phone if available??
